Ionics, Inc., a leading player in the electronics manufacturing services industry, is headquartered in the Philippines. Founded in 1972, the company has established a strong presence in key operational regions across Asia and North America. Specialising in advanced manufacturing solutions, Ionics offers a diverse range of services, including printed circuit board assembly and supply chain management, which are distinguished by their commitment to quality and innovation. With a focus on serving the telecommunications, automotive, and consumer electronics sectors, Ionics has achieved significant milestones, including ISO certifications that underscore its dedication to excellence. Ionics, Inc., headquartered in the Philippines, currently does not report any car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of specific figures in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ges associated with the company. This lack of data suggests that Ionics, Inc. may not have established formal commitments to reduce its carbon footprint or engage in climate initiatives at this time.
